Paris base for BA's new OpenSkies airline

Ba open skies

BA will start flights this year from Paris to New York through its subsidiary airline OpenSkies

IN an interesting move, British Airways (BA) is to go head-to-head with Air France when it launches flights from Brussels and Paris to New York.

BA is to start a new subsidiary airline called OpenSkies, in recognition of last year's agreement between Europe and America which tore down restrictions on the flights available across the Atlantic.

The airline will launch in June 2008 with one Boeing 757 aircraft that will operate from New York to either Brussels or Paris Charles de Gaulle airports.

A second aircraft will be added to the fleet later this year to fly to the other EU destination. The plan is to operate six 757s by the end of 2009, all of which will be sourced from the current British Airways' fleet.

It is still not clear which airport in New York the BA service will operate to, it could fly to John F. Kennedy airport or Newark in New Jersey, and the move comes as Air France looks to take over Alitalia and other airlines such as Virgin and BMI appear to be jockeying for position as the skies across the Atlantic open up.

British Airways' chief executive Willie Walsh said: "This is an exciting new venture for us and we're confident that it will be a great success as we build on the strength of British Airways' brand in the US and Europe.

"By naming the airline OpenSkies, we're celebrating the first major step in 60 years towards a liberalised US/EU aviation market which means we can fly between any US and EU destination. It also signals our determination to lobby for further liberalisation in this market when talks between the EU and US take place later this year."
